Audio Book: A Christmas Carol by Charles Dickens

  • by

A Christmas Carol recounts the story of Ebenezer Scrooge, an elderly miser who is visited by the ghost of his former business partner Jacob Marley and the spirits of Christmas Past, Present and Yet to Come. After their visits, Scrooge is transformed into a kinder, gentler man.

Audio Library: Tryst with Destiny Speech by Jawaharlal Nehru

Tryst with Destiny was a speech delivered by Pandit Jawaharlal Nehru, the first Prime Minister of independent India, on the eve of India’s Independence on midnight of August 14, 1947. Considered to be one of the greatest speeches of the 20th Century, Tryst with Destiny captures the Indian Independence struggle against the Bristish empire.
